Twenty-one passengers were injured when a Delta flight from Minneapolis crash-landed in Toronto on Monday. It’s the fourth American plane accident in less than a month. Many are questioning the safety of flying. A reporter on the aviation beat joined Minnesota Now to talk about what he’s seeing.

Burnsville is remembering three first responders who were killed in the line of duty a year ago Tuesday. Leaders of the city's police and fire departments joined the show to reflect back on their years.

Olympic skier Jessie Diggins is joining a Minnesota-based treatment center in raising awareness about eating disorders and recovery. She talked to MPR News host Nina Moini about what it took for her to get help.

We dove into the world of competitive ethics with two Minnesota college students who are headed to nationals.

The Minnesota Music Minute was ‘Like the Sea’ by Wild Horses and the Song of the Day was ‘Fear Met Me’ by LaSonya Natividad.
